Low Light Photography

It is challenging to capture a good photograph in a low-light environment. In this project, we want to make photographing under low-light conditions easier by taking advantage of the computational capability of digital cameras and the development of image processing and other techniques.

Enhancing Photographs with Near Infrared Images

Near Infra-Red (NIR) images of natural scenes usually have better contrast and contain rich texture details that may not be perceived in visible light photographs (VIS). We propose a novel method to enhance a photograph by using the contrast and texture information of its corresponding NIR image.

Deblurring in Digital Photography
Deblurring is a very challenging and useful research topic and successful solution of this problem will benefit a large amount of digital camera consumers and certainly the manufacturers of digital cameras. We are trying to improve conventional image restoration methods and discover novel approaches which integrate with other deblurring modalities.
Rain Removal in Video
Removal of rain streaks in video is a challenging problem due to the random spatial distribution and fast motion of rain. We present a new rain removal algorithm that incorporates both temporal and chromatic properties of rain in video.
